Latest Patents
Alessio holds a patent for a "Magnetic structure for circular ion accelerator." This invention features a magnet structure designed for use in circular ion accelerators, such as synchrocyclotrons. The design includes a cold-mass structure with superconducting magnetic coils, at least one dry cryocooler unit for cooling, and a magnetic yoke structure with a return yoke configured radially around the coils. The return yoke has an opening that accommodates the dry cryocooler unit, ensuring thermal contact with the cold-mass structure.
